Allan Francis DOWD

Regimental number56
Place of birthCassilis New South Wales
ReligionRoman Catholic
OccupationLabourer
AddressWerris Creek, New South Wales
Marital statusSingle
Age at embarkation18
Next of kinMother, Mrs R Dowd, Werris Creek, New South Wales
Enlistment date24 November 1915
Rank on enlistmentPrivate
Unit name33rd Battalion, A Company
AWM Embarkation Roll number23/50/1
Embarkation detailsUnit embarked from Sydney, New South Wales, on board HMAT A74 Marathon on 4 May 1916
Rank from Nominal RollPrivate
Unit from Nominal Roll1st Battalion
FateReturned to Australia 21 July 1917
Family/military connectionsBrother: 584 Pte Joseph DOWD, 2nd Bn, died of wounds, 29 October 1917.
Other details

War service: Western Front

Medals: British War Medal, Victory Medal
Date of death6 August 1972
Place of burialWoronora Cemetery
